Head Lice Quick Facts
-
Head lice are insects that feed on the human scalp.
-
Head lice move from head-to-head, usually by direct head-to-head contact.
-
Head lice are just as likely to infest a clean head as they are a dirty one.
-
Head lice are common and can be a problem for anyone. Your child should not feel bad because they have head lice.
-
The American Academy of Pediatrics estimates that 6 to 12 million people get head lice in the US each year.
-
When a louse bites the scalp, the saliva they leave behind can cause the scalp to itch.
-
Head lice are NOT known to carry disease. While the thought of bugs in your child's hair may be upsetting, there's no reason to panic.
-
There are many treatments available to help you with your head lice problem. But you should always consider consulting a health care professional to help you choose the right treatment for your child.
